On September 19 2011 18:40 zalz wrote:
I wonder wether 400g is worth the advantage of being able to clear out wards and opening your lane for the jungler.

Most oracles only come into play when the lane phase is over but perhaps certain supports can get away with getting it as their 2nd item. Opening oracles might be pushing it.


Still it would be a waste to spend 400g so early on an oracle wich you could end up losing. You would have to be a 100% sure that your jungler is a good player. If the jungler is bad then the other team can just play super agressive and try to kill you.

Hell playing super agressive might even prevent you from being able to get to the river wards and take them down.

As a support I don't tend to get oracles early cause I'm not brave and assume I'll die.
But when I'm on a tankier jungler like WW if i get even a little ahead early game I'll buy it on my first or second trip back to base. The earlier you grab an oracles(assuming you play safe and keep it for a bit) the stronger hold of map control you can take early, snowballing the game towards your team.
